1     Personal Data and Processing

Personal data means any information relating to an identified or identifiable natural person; an identifiable natural person can be identified, directly or indirectly, in particular by reference to an identifier such as, for example, a name, an identification number, location data or an online identifier.

Processing means any operation which is performed on personal data, whether or not by automated means, such as collection, recording, organisation, structuring, storage, consultation, erasure or destruction, etc.

  1. Browsing Data

The IT systems and software procedures for the operation of the website acquire, during normal operation, some personal data the transmission of which is implicit in the use of Internet communication protocols. This information is not collected to be associated with identified parties concerned, but by its very nature could, through processing and association with data held by third parties, allow identifying users. This category of data includes the IP addresses or domain names of computers used by users connecting to the website, URI (Uniform Resource Identifier) addresses of the requested resources, the time of the request, the method used to submit the request to the server, the size of the file obtained in response, the numerical code indicating the status of the response from the server (successful, error, etc.) and other parameters relating to the operating system and the user’s IT environment. These data are only used to obtain anonymous, statistical information regarding website use, to verify its correct operation, to identify anomalies and/or abuses, and are deleted immediately after processing. The data could be used to ascertain liability in case of hypothetical computer crimes against the Data Controller or third parties.

8 Rights of the data subject

The User has the right to obtain confirmation as to whether or not personal data concerning him or her are being processed and, where that is the case, the User can exercise the following rights:

  • right to access to the personal data to obtain information about the purposes of the processing; the recipients to whom the personal data have been or will be disclosed; where possible, the envisaged period for which the personal data will be stored; the envisaged consequences of the processing based on profiling;
  • right to withdraw consent at any time, without affecting the lawfulness of processing based on consent before its withdrawal;
  • right to obtain the rectification of inaccurate or incomplete personal data concerning him or her;
  • right to obtain the erasure of personal data if they are no longer necessary the purposes for which they were collected or otherwise processed, are inadequate with respect to the purposes of the processing, the User has revoked his/her consent or the data has been processed unlawfully;
  • right to restrict processing, if provided by applicable law;
  • request the transfer of data to another Data Controller, in a commonly used and machine-readable format, without impediments from the current Data Controller;
  • right to object to the processing of personal data concerning him or her. Specifically, the User has the right not to be subject to a decision based solely on automated processing, including profiling;
  • right to lodge a complaint with a supervisory authority, if the User considers that the processing of personal data relating to him or her infringes the applicable law.
